- Abstract
- In this study, we tried to explore the service cooperation strategy of airports and airlines, which are the key players in the aviation service industry, from the perspective of consumers. For this purpose, review data were collected from airport users and airline customers, and text mining techniques were used to identify service keywords for both the airport and the airline. Then, the importance of each keyword was measured by using a network analysis. The service coordination strategies of the two entities were explored by analyzing the service matrix for airports and airlines based on the derived core services and their importance. The analysis results are summarized as follows: First, customer’s text mining was able to identify core services of airports and airlines from the customer’s point of view. Second, the connectivity between airports and airline service factors can be grasped. Third, a service strategy for cooperation between airports and airlines is required for service cooperation by importance level. ? 2018 The Korean Physical Society. All Rights Reserved.
